A series of seminars were organized for municipal personnel as part of the cooperation protocol signed between Ondokuz Mayıs University (OMU) and Atakum Municipality.
The seminar program began on October 4 last year and covered ten current topics, ranging from financial literacy to local governance. Organized by the Atakum Municipality Human Resources and Training Directorate, the seminars took place in the Municipal Council Meeting Hall with a high level of participation.
OMU Faculty Member Prof. Dr. Ahmet Mutlu from the Department of Political Science and Public Administration coordinated the program, which hosted OMU academics over a period of four months.
